symptom severity scales

Symptom severity scales are tools used to measure how intense or debilitating a person's symptoms are, often in relation to health conditions. They typically range from mild to severe, allowing individuals to self-report their experiences. This helps healthcare professionals understand the impact of symptoms on a person’s daily life, enabling better treatment plans. Examples include scales that ask patients to rate pain or anxiety levels from 1 to 10. By assessing severity, doctors can tailor care and monitor progress, ultimately enhancing patient outcomes.
